Navigating Legal Proceedings After a Cruise Assault

Navigating legal proceedings after a cruise assault can be a complex and emotionally challenging process for victims. In such cases, it’s crucial to seek assistance from experienced cruise line sexual assault attorneys in Indiana who specialize in these unique circumstances. These legal professionals understand the intricacies of maritime law and the specific challenges that arise when pursuing justice on international waters. One significant aspect is the application of different jurisdictions and laws, as cruise ships often operate under flags of convenience, complicating legal oversight.
Victims should be aware that the timeline for filing a claim against a cruise line is typically stringent, often limited by the terms of the passenger ticket. Cruise line sexual assault attorneys in Indiana can help navigate these time constraints and ensure all necessary documentation is in order. They will guide victims through gathering evidence, including medical records, security footage (if available), and witness statements. This meticulous process is essential to build a strong case, especially considering the potential for evidence to be scattered across various locations and time zones.
